site stats

C++ hashtable stl

Web哈希表v/s STL映射在C++; 我正在努力学习C++地图。我只是想知道STL映射的实现。我读到它使用二叉搜索树,c++,hashtable,hashmap,C++,Hashtable,Hashmap,STL中是否有哈希表的实现 STL映射如何准确地存储键值对 典型的STL实现基于红黑树。 WebMar 12, 2024 · C++ Hash Table Implementation. We can implement hashing by using arrays or linked lists to program the hash tables. In C++ we also have a feature called “hash map” which is a structure similar to a hash table but each entry is a key-value pair. In C++ its called hash map or simply a map. Hash map in C++ is usually unordered.

金三银四C++面试考点之哈希表(std::unordered_map) - 掘金

WebFeb 27, 2024 · Separate Chaining using STL. Algorithm: The algorithm for the approach is mentioned below: Initialize the size (say n) of vectors. While adding an element, go through the following steps: Get the value of x=” … WebJul 15, 2016 · STL是C++重要的组件之一,大学时看过《STL源码剖析》这本书,这几天复习了一下,总结出以下LZ认为比较重要的知识点,内容有点略多 :) 1、STL概述 STL提供六大组件,彼此可以组合套用: ... hashtable这种结构在插入、删除、查找具有“常数平均时间”,而 … physiotherapy for breathing pattern disorders https://sportssai.com

The C++ Standard Template Library - Vanderbilt University

WebHash Tables. The Abseil container library contains a number of useful hash tables generally adhering to the STL container API contract: absl::flat_hash_map; absl::flat_hash_set ... WebMar 24, 2024 · STL中的hash_table:unordered_map,hash_map底层都使用了hash_table,这在STL一般是采用开链法解决hash冲突的,那什么是hash冲突呢,Hash … WebJul 23, 2014 · We can get an answer by mimicking Boost and combining hashes. Warning: Combining hashes, i.e. computing a hash of many things from many hashes of the … tooth images cute

c++ - 使用在一對int,int和int上模板化的映射來實現一個備忘錄表 …

Category:Hash Tables - ModernesCpp.com

Tags:C++ hashtable stl

C++ hashtable stl

The C++ Standard Template Library - Vanderbilt University

WebUnordered Map is a data structure that maps key value pairs using Hash Table. This article is focused on what Buckets mean in Hashing and the function unordered_map::bucket … WebJul 30, 2024 · C Program to Implement Hash Tables chaining with Singly Linked Lists - A hash table is a data structure which is used to store key-value pairs. Hash function is used by hash table to compute an index into an array in which an element will be inserted or searched.This is a C++ program to Implement Hash Tables chaining with singly …

C++ hashtable stl

Did you know?

WebApr 11, 2013 · I am very new to C++ and I am working on creating a program using HashTables. This is for homework. This is the first time I am using and creating HashTables, so forgive me in advance as to I don't know entirely what I am doing. WebJun 14, 2024 · (Boolan) C++ STL与泛型编程. 对于现在的计算机编程语言来说,语言和库已经形成了两大体系。只学一门语言可以实现自己想要的功能,也可以写出各式各样的程序,但是,不得已需要提一句,...

Web我只是想知道STL映射的实现。我读到它使用二叉搜索树,c++,hashtable,hashmap,C++,Hashtable,Hashmap,STL中是否有哈希表的实现 STL映 … WebA Hash table is basically a data structure that is used to store the key value pair. In C++, a hash table uses the hash function to compute the index in an array at which the value needs to be stored or searched. This …

WebThe C++ STL Douglas C. Schmidt STL Features: Containers, Iterators, & Algorithms • Containers – Sequential: vector, deque, list – Associative: set, multiset, map, multimap – Adapters: stack, queue, priority queue • Iterators – Input, output, forward, bidirectional, & random access – Each container declares a trait for the type of iterator it provides Web1、HashTable.h; 2、unordered_map; 3、unordered_set; 4、test.cpp; 一、unordered 系列关联式容器. 在 C++98 中,STL 提供了底层为红黑树结构的一系列关联式容器,在查询 …

WebC++ : Hash Table v/s STL map in C++To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I promised to share a hidden feature with ...

WebThe Policy Hash Table has 3-6x faster insertion/deletion and 4-10x increase for writes/reads. As far as I can tell, there are no downsides. The policy hash table (specifically the open-addressing version), beats out unordered_map in all my benchmarks. PS: Make sure you read the section a better hash function and use it — I'd recommend this ... physiotherapy for broken wristWebThe Policy Hash Table has 3-6x faster insertion/deletion and 4-10x increase for writes/reads. As far as I can tell, there are no downsides. The policy hash table (specifically the open … tooth implant fort collinsWebNov 24, 2016 · Hash Tables. We missed the hash table in C++ for a long time. They promise to have constant access time. C++11 has hash tables in four variations. The official name is unordered associative containers. … physiotherapy for broken ankle recoveryWebUnordered Map is a data structure that maps key value pairs using Hash Table. This article is focused on what Buckets mean in Hashing and the function unordered_map::bucket for unordered map container in C++ STL. This function is used to check if 2 elements have the same hash and hence, falls into the same bucket. The syntax of using it is: tooth implant procedure flowoodWeb我定義了以下類型 使用自定義 hash function 如下 我已經聲明了兩張地圖如下 我也有兩個變量point p和line l我適當地分配。 當我執行points.find p 時,它可以正常工作。 但是,當我使用lines.find l 時,我得到了無窮無盡的錯誤行,如下所示 adsbygo physiotherapy for cardiac rehabilitationWebC++ STL – Containers •four different types of containers –unordered associative containers (require C++11) •unordered_(multi)map/set –unordered_map will work as a hash map! •can take a key, a value, and a hash function •hash maps are inherently unordered, which is why a regular map container won’t work physiotherapy for bursitis in hipWeb2 days ago · C++回调函数以及epoll中回调函数的使用. 回调函数是一种常用的编程技术,它允许程序在运行时将一个函数作为参数传递给另一个函数,以实现更加灵活和可扩展的功能。. 在C++中,回调函数通常被实现为函数指针或者函数对象。. 函数指针是指向函数的指针变量 ... physiotherapy for breathing disorders